
So implementieren Sie eine verknüpfte Liste in Go
Go implementiert verknüpfte Listen durch Definieren einer Knotenstruktur, Definieren einer verknüpften Listenstruktur, Definieren einiger Methoden zum Betreiben der verknüpften Liste, Implementieren einer Methode zum Löschen eines Knotens in der verknüpften Liste und Implementieren einer Methode zum Drucken aller Knoten in der verknüpften Liste.


So implementieren Sie eine verknüpfte Liste in Go

JavaScript-Programm zum Ermitteln der Länge einer verknüpften Liste
Die verknüpfte Liste ist eine lineare Datenstruktur, deren Länge variabel sein kann. Dies ist das Problem, dass die Länge des Arrays nicht geändert werden kann. In diesem Artikel ermitteln wir die Länge einer bestimmten verknüpften Liste, indem wir den Code implementieren und Randfälle prüfen. In diesem Artikel werden wir die While-Schleife und das Klassenkonzept verwenden. Einführung in das Problem Bei dem gegebenen Problem erhalten wir eine verknüpfte Liste. Zuerst müssen wir die verknüpfte Liste mithilfe von Klassen erstellen und dann die Länge der angegebenen verknüpften Liste ermitteln. Da sich die Länge der verknüpften Liste ändern kann, ermitteln wir die Länge der verknüpften Liste an einem bestimmten Codepunkt. Wir werden zwei Methoden verwenden: Die erste ist die direkte iterative Methode, die eine While-Schleife verwendet, und die andere ist die rekursive Methode, um die Länge der gegebenen verknüpften Liste zu ermitteln. Iterative Methode In dieser Methode werden wir zunächst
Aug 26, 2023 pm 08:01 PM
JavaScript-Programm zum Austauschen von Knoten in einer verknüpften Liste ohne Datenaustausch
Ein JavaScript-Programm, das Knoten in einer verknüpften Liste austauscht, ohne Daten auszutauschen, ist ein häufiges Problem bei der Webentwicklung, bei dem die Reihenfolge der Knoten in einer verknüpften Liste neu angeordnet wird. Eine verknüpfte Liste ist eine Datenstruktur, die aus Knoten besteht, wobei jeder Knoten ein Datenelement und einen Verweis auf den nächsten Knoten in der Liste enthält. In diesem Artikel lernen wir ein vollständiges Tutorial zum Austausch von Knoten in einer verknüpften Liste ohne Datenaustausch mithilfe von JavaScript. Definieren wir also zunächst den Austauschknoten und fahren dann mit dem Tutorial fort. Also, lerne weiter! Knoten tauschen Das Tauschen von Knoten in einer verknüpften Liste bedeutet, dass wir die Positionen zweier Knoten tauschen. Es gibt viele Möglichkeiten, Knoten in einer verknüpften Liste auszutauschen. Eine Möglichkeit besteht darin, die Daten in den Knoten auszutauschen. Bei großen Datenmengen kann dies jedoch der Fall sein
Aug 24, 2023 pm 08:05 PM
JavaScript-Programm zum Drehen verknüpfter Listen im Uhrzeigersinn
Die Grundstruktur einer verknüpften Liste in JavaScript kann mithilfe von Klassen in JavaScript erstellt werden. Anschließend können Knoten zur Rotation von einer Position an eine andere verschoben werden. In diesem Artikel erfahren Sie, wie Sie eine verknüpfte Liste in der Programmiersprache JavaScript im Uhrzeigersinn drehen. Wir werden Code für ein tieferes Verständnis dieser Konzepte sehen. In der gegebenen Aufgabe erhalten wir eine verknüpfte Liste und müssen diese im Uhrzeigersinn drehen. Das bedeutet, dass wir bei jeder Bewegung das letzte Element zuerst platzieren müssen. Wenn wir k-mal rotieren müssen, müssen wir das letzte Element vor dem Kopf oder Startknoten der verknüpften Liste platzieren. Um die verknüpfte Liste zu erstellen, die wir zuvor gesehen haben, benötigen wir eine Klasse zum Kombinieren der Daten und einen Zeiger auf das nächste Element.
Aug 25, 2023 am 11:37 AM
Golang-Entwicklung: Verwenden Sie Prometheus, um die Anwendungsleistung zu überwachen
Golang-Entwicklung: Die Verwendung von Prometheus zur Überwachung der Anwendungsleistung erfordert spezifische Codebeispiele. Zusammenfassung: Dieser Artikel stellt vor, wie die Prometheus-Bibliothek in der Golang-Entwicklung zur Überwachung der Anwendungsleistung verwendet wird, und bietet spezifische Codebeispiele, um Entwicklern den schnellen Einstieg zu erleichtern. Einleitung: In der modernen Anwendungsentwicklung ist die Überwachung der Anwendungsleistung ein sehr wichtiger Schritt. Durch die Überwachung können wir den Betriebsstatus der Anwendung in Echtzeit verstehen, Probleme rechtzeitig erkennen und Anpassungen vornehmen und so die Stabilität und Leistung der Anwendung verbessern. Profi
Sep 21, 2023 pm 12:39 PM
So entwickeln Sie eine Echtzeit-Datensynchronisierungsfunktion mit MongoDB
So entwickeln Sie mithilfe von MongoDB eine Echtzeit-Datensynchronisierungsfunktion. Im heutigen Internetzeitalter wird die Echtzeit-Datensynchronisierungsfunktion immer wichtiger. Um den Anforderungen der Benutzer nach Unmittelbarkeit gerecht zu werden, müssen Entwickler effiziente und skalierbare Datenbanken verwenden, um Datensynchronisierungsfunktionen zu implementieren. Als leistungsstarke verteilte Dokumentendatenbank bietet MongoDB einige Funktionen und Tools, die uns bei der Datensynchronisierung in Echtzeit helfen können. Im Folgenden wird die Verwendung von MongoDB zum Entwickeln einer Echtzeit-Datensynchronisierungsfunktion vorgestellt und einige spezifische Codebeispiele bereitgestellt.
Sep 21, 2023 am 10:09 AM
So implementieren Sie eine verknüpfte Liste in Go
Go implementiert verknüpfte Listen durch Definieren einer Knotenstruktur, Definieren einer verknüpften Listenstruktur, Definieren einiger Methoden zum Betreiben der verknüpften Liste, Implementieren einer Methode zum Löschen eines Knotens in der verknüpften Liste und Implementieren einer Methode zum Drucken aller Knoten in der verknüpften Liste. Detaillierte Einführung: 1. Definieren Sie eine Knotenstruktur, die Daten und einen Zeiger auf den nächsten Knoten enthält. 2. Definieren Sie eine verknüpfte Listenstruktur, die einen Zeiger auf den Kopfknoten der verknüpften Liste enthält verknüpfte Liste, und Sie müssen eine Methode implementieren, um einen Knoten am Ende der verknüpften Liste usw. einzufügen.
Sep 25, 2023 pm 01:57 PM
Heißer Artikel

Heiße Werkzeuge

Kits AI
Verwandeln Sie Ihre Stimme mit KI-Künstlerstimmen. Erstellen und trainieren Sie Ihr eigenes KI-Sprachmodell.

SOUNDRAW - AI Music Generator
Erstellen Sie ganz einfach Musik für Videos, Filme und mehr mit dem KI-Musikgenerator von SOUNDRAW.

Web ChatGPT.ai
Kostenlose Chrome -Erweiterung mit OpenAI -Chatbot für ein effizientes Surfen.

ROK Solution
Plattform für keine Codeanwendungen und organisatorische Modellierung mit KI.

aigirlfriend
Die neueste und beste KI -Freundin auf dem Markt. Sie können ein aufregendes Date mit Ihrem geliebten Mädchen verbringen und ein unvergessliches Foto für jede aufregende Szene erstellen.
